What bucket data should buyers send before price confirmation?

The safest quote starts with machine identity, bucket width, pin diameter, pin-center distance, ear width, coupler type and wear photos.

A bucket for a 20-ton excavator is not automatically interchangeable with every machine in that weight class. Stick width, coupler design, pin boss spacing and pin diameter can vary by model, configuration and previous modification. If a buyer only asks for an excavator bucket for sale by width, the supplier may quote a bucket that looks right in photos but cannot be installed without rework.

PRIMA should ask the buyer to send a simple evidence file before final price confirmation. The file should include the machine model and serial number, photos of the old bucket or coupler, pin measurements, desired bucket width, material type, destination port and whether the buyer needs new, used or rebuilt condition. This turns the quote from a generic attachment offer into a controlled fitment decision.

How to confirm pin size, ear width and pin-center distance

Fitment should be measured at the bucket lugs and coupler connection, not guessed from the model name.

The most important bucket measurements are pin diameter, distance between pin centers, inside ear width and the width of the dipper-stick or quick-coupler connection. Buyers should photograph the ruler or caliper in place, because written numbers can be transcribed incorrectly when several buckets are being compared.

For quick couplers, the buyer should also identify whether the coupler uses a pin-on, wedge, hydraulic quick hitch or brand-specific design. A bucket may match the excavator size but fail the coupler geometry. If the old bucket has been welded or modified, PRIMA should treat the measurement photos as more important than catalog assumptions.

Measurement Where to check Why it matters
Pin diameter Bucket pin or pin hole Pin fit and bushing match
Pin-center distance Center of front pin to rear pin Linkage/coupler geometry
Ear width Inside distance between lugs Dipper-stick or coupler fit

How to choose bucket teeth, adaptors and cutting-edge options

Bucket teeth and adaptors should match the bucket type, machine size and material, not only the lowest unit price.

A general digging bucket, rock bucket, trenching bucket and cleaning bucket may use different tooth layouts, plate thickness and wear protection. For parts buyers, the tooth system matters because a cheap tooth that does not match the adaptor creates downtime and loose fit. Buyers should confirm tooth model, pin/retainer style, adaptor condition and whether the bucket needs side cutters or extra wear strips.

How to judge used bucket wear before export

Used buckets can be good value, but the buyer needs clear photos of cracks, plate wear, lug wear and tooth condition.

A used excavator bucket should be inspected like a structural part. The shell, floor plate, side plates, heel area, lugs, bushings and weld repairs should be visible. A bucket with heavy plate wear may still be usable for light work, but the price and buyer expectation must match the condition. Photos should show both the working face and the mounting end.

For export buyers, condition grading is also a dispute-prevention tool. If the buyer accepts a used bucket with visible wear after reviewing photos, the transaction is clearer. If the bucket has cracks near the lugs or heavy deformation, PRIMA should either reject it or quote repair work explicitly instead of hiding the risk.

Wear point Photo needed Why it matters
Lugs and bushings Close-up of pin holes Controls mounting looseness
Shell/floor Inside and outside photos Shows remaining service life
Weld repairs Clear repair area photos Shows structural risk

How PRIMA prepares bucket packing and shipment evidence

Bucket shipment evidence should show the actual bucket, protected sharp points, loading method and document file.

Buckets are heavy and awkward, so packing is more about securing the shape than hiding it inside a box. Teeth or cutting edges should be protected, and the bucket should be fixed so it cannot damage other cargo. If buckets are nested or shipped with other parts, buyers should receive batch photos before loading.
